This guide is dedicated to the exhaustive presentation of the 7 families of butterflies, thus describing the characteristics specific to these families, subfamilies, tribes and genera.

It is illustrated with 350 photographs of live butterflies, captured in their natural habitat in around forty countries. These photos allow us to understand colour and shape as a means of survival.

Adrian Hoskins is a renowned entomologist and nature photographer. A specialist in butterflies, he has observed them for 35 years across the world, from the woods and meadows of Europe to the rainforests of South America, Africa and Southeast Asia. He is the discoverer of several species.
